Nvidia CEO Jensen Huang Predicts Ongoing AI Boom and Multi-Trillion Dollar Market

Nvidia CEO Jensen Huang recently reassured investors that the artificial intelligence (AI) boom is far from over. Speaking amidst concerns of slowing growth in AI stocks, Huang emphasized that demand for AI chips remains strong, especially from Big Tech firms and data center owners. He projected that the AI industry could become a multi-trillion-dollar market within the next five years.

Strong Demand Fuels Optimism

Nvidia, a leader in AI hardware, has seen its products become the backbone for companies investing in advanced technologies. Huang pointed out that the constant need for faster, more efficient AI chips will continue to drive growth. Despite recent volatility in AI stock prices, Nvidia’s CEO remains confident that the AI revolution is just beginning. He highlighted that the ongoing digital transformation across industries ensures a robust future for AI investments.
